For the 2024 school year, there are 20 private elementary schools belonging to national association of independent schools (nais) serving 7,208 students in Indiana. You can also find more schools membership associations in Indiana.
The top ranked belonging to national association of independent schools (nais) private elementary schools in Indiana include Park Tudor School, Canterbury School and Evansville Day School.
The average acceptance rate is 81%, which is lower than the Indiana private elementary school average acceptance rate of 88%.
